Output 7c521e8e1cde87658034149152001efe55cdd6f368169d87c82972e82f50d042:31

value
169336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3adb87b1790181ea1b1e5fc7655e7cec14f577cb OP_EQUAL
address
374E6tJUa3Mw3REmfrvCvJ1UHNtm8qgL7X
transaction
7c521e8e1cde87658034149152001efe55cdd6f368169d87c82972e82f50d042
spent
true